Dandelion juice benefits and functions

Dandelion is a common wild vegetable in spring. It is also called mother-in-law and yellow flower seedling. Dandelion is rich in nutrients and has good therapeutic and medicinal value. Therefore, many people will dig some dandelions to eat in spring. When the dandelions are mature in autumn, people will use dandelions to make tea, which will relieve many diseases in the body.
